Women's Training Program -- Begins Monday, April 28!

The Women's Training Program (WTP) is an 8-week program for women run by women held each Spring.  All women 16 years and above are welcome to join us who want to begin or improve their run or walk programs.  Participants meet on Monday evenings from April 28th thru June 16th.  WTP registration is now open.

RESTON RUNNERS          

Reston Runners is based in Reston, Virginia and is a proud member of the Road Runners Club of America. We are one of the largest running clubs in Northern Virginia with a diverse range of athletic talent. Many new club members are training for their first 5K or 10K. Others are experienced runners who have run competitively and have completed dozens of marathons and ultramarathons. We are passionate about running (and walking) and strive to be fun and inclusive. As our name "Reston Runners" implies--we are a running club. However, we also have a very active group who prefer to walk. Our weekend events include both a run and a walk course.
